This is probably a really obvious answer for those in the know, but for me, I'm still in the initial conceptual brain fog of hooking up all my equipment on a new build. I have a Pentair Intellicenter (upgrade to an Easytouch 8) and a Pentair Mastertemp 400 gas heater. I've run 120 volts to the heater and low voltage to the RS485 hookup and back to the Intellicenter. Does the Intellicenter handle all the switching of power to the Mastertemp (in which case I DON'T use a relay, just wire direct to the breaker) or do I need to use one of my relays to switch it in some way?

Wire the 120 volts directly to the heater, not through a relay.

Make sure you have the 120V voltage selection plug installed in the heater

The RS-485 control from the IntelliCenter tells the heater when to run. The heater needs power on to respond to the RS-485 commands.
